One way you can do this is, go to https://musicbrainz.org/, in the top right search box search for the artist, find the correct artist from the search results, find the correct album in the list, then in the release group for that album you should probably find the release that says CD in the format column and says either US or your country in the country column. The release ID is after `/release/` in that url. +You can also now tell lidarr to create an entry for the album and artist with ```python -from slskdsearch import get_album, search # skip this if you've copied the functions into your project -MBID = "2e789ca4-020c-37ec-9f64-236c9ae1bd5f" -album = get_album(MBID) -search(album) -# while this is running, check the searches list on slskd, you should see the search progress -# if the search was successful, the function will return True, and the full album will be downloading in the download list in slskd -# if the search was not successful or was not entirely successful, the function will return the search ID, and you should go to /searches/ in slskd to manually select the files you want +lidarr_album = add_album_to_lidarr(release_id) ``` + +So far I haven't been able to get Lidarr to import the files from my unsorted folder automatically, you'll want to go to `/wanted/missing`, click Manual Import, and import it like that.
